Orion's Exploration Design Challenge Winner Announced

Radiation Experiment To Fly Into Space On Exploration Flight Test-1

After a year-long competition among the nation's high schools, evaluators from NASA, Lockheed Martin, and the National Institute of Aerospace (NIA) have selected Team ARES from the Governor's School for Science and Technology in Hampton, VA. as the winner of the Exploration Design Challenge. The winner was chosen from a group of five finalist teams announced in March 2014.

The Challenge was developed to engage students in science, technology, engineering and math by inviting them to help tackle one of the most significant dangers of human space flight—radiation exposure.

The winning team's design received the highest radiation protection score during an online simulation of radiation exposure. They also demonstrated evidence of additional research outside of the material provided, and included additional information about the materials and estimated cost for their experiment.

Team ARES will now work with the NASA and Lockheed Martin spacecraft integration team to have their experiment approved to fly in space. When the equipment is approved, Lockheed Martin engineers will install it onto Orion's crew module. Later this year when Orion launches into orbit during Exploration Flight Test-1 (EFT-1), Lockheed Martin will host Team ARES at Kennedy Space Center in Florida to watch their experiment launch into space.

During EFT-1, Orion will fly through the Van Allen Belt, a dense radiation field that surrounds the Earth in a protective shell of electrically charged ions. Understanding and mitigating radiation exposure during Orion's test flight can help scientists develop protective solutions before the first crewed mission. After EFT-1, the students will receive data indicating how well their design protected a dosimeter, an instrument used for measuring radiation exposure.
